随着科技的发展和数字经济的崛起,加密货币作为一种新兴的支付方式正在逐渐改变我们传统的金融体系。尤其是比特币、以太坊等主流加密货币的出现,为全球的支付系统提供了极大的便利和创新。本文将深入探讨加密货币支付的开发,理解其工作原理、优势和面临的挑战,最终帮助开发者和企业构建一个更加高效和安全的支付系统。
什么是加密货币支付?
加密货币支付是指使用加密货币作为交易手段进行的支付方式。这种支付方式与传统的法定货币(如美元、欧元等)不同,它基于区块链技术,通过去中心化的网络进行交易。每一笔交易都被记录在区块链上,允许用户直接进行点对点的交易,而不需要中介机构的干预,如银行或支付处理商。
加密货币的诞生源于对传统金融系统的不满,特别是在于其透明度、交易速度和费用等方面。通过去中心化的网络,区块链可以提高交易的透明度,降低交易成本,并实现更快的交易处理速度。这不仅为消费者提供了更好的用户体验,同时也为商家带来了更多的业务机会。
加密货币支付的优势
加密货币支付具有多方面的优势,以下是其中一些主要优点:
- 去中心化:传统支付系统依赖于中介机构,如银行和支付网关。加密货币支付通过区块链技术实现去中心化,使得交易更为安全和可靠。
- 低交易费用:相比传统支付方式,加密货币支付通常具有更低的交易费用。这对于国际贸易、在线购物等场景尤为重要,因其可以避免高额的跨境手续费。
- 快速交易:加密货币交易的处理速度通常非常快,特别是在传统银行转账可能需要数天的情况下,加密货币可以在几分钟内完成交易。
- 隐私保护:虽然区块链的交易是公开透明的,但用户的身份信息可以保持匿名。这为某些需要隐私保护的交易提供了保障。
- 全球可接入性:对于很多没有银行账户的地区,加密货币提供了一种新的支付手段,允许人们参与全球经济。
如何开发加密货币支付系统
开发一个加密货币支付系统需要技术、法律和市场等多方面的考虑,下面我们来探讨一下主要步骤:
1. 确定需求,选择合适的加密货币
在开发加密货币支付系统之前,首先需要明确自己的需求。不同的加密货币适合不同的用途。例如,比特币常用于大额交易,而以太坊支持智能合约,适合复杂交易。选择合适的加密货币将直接影响系统的架构和功能。
2. 搭建区块链架构
加密货币支付系统的核心是其区块链架构。可以选择使用现有的区块链网络,也可以根据需求构建自己的区块链。构建自己的区块链是一个复杂的过程,需要开发团队具备一定的区块链技术能力,包括共识机制、钱包创建、节点配置等。
3. 开发钱包系统
加密货币支付系统需要一个高安全性的钱包系统,以便于用户存储和管理他们的加密资产。钱包可以分为热钱包和冷钱包,前者适合日常交易,后者更为安全,适合长期存储。开发钱包时,需要关注安全性与用户体验。
4. 设计用户界面
用户界面是支付系统与用户最直接的接触点,良好的用户体验可以显著提升用户的满意度。需要设计一个直观、易用的界面,让用户在使用加密货币进行交易时,能够清晰地看到交易详情。
5. 合规与安全
加密货币的合法性在不同国家和地区存在差异,因此开发过程中必须考虑合规性问题。同时,安全性是支付系统的重中之重,确保系统能够抵御黑客攻击、欺诈等风险。
6. 测试与上线
在系统开发完成后,需要进行全面的测试,以确保系统的稳定性和安全性。在通过严格的测试后,才可以将系统上线,并及时根据用户反馈进行调优。
可能面临的挑战
尽管加密货币支付具有诸多优势,但在开发和推广过程中也面临着一些挑战:
- 法律合规性:全球范围内,加密货币的法律地位尚不明确,不同地区对其监管政策不同。开发者需要密切关注法规变化,以确保合规。
- 安全性加密货币钱包和交易平台常常成为黑客攻击的目标,保障用户资产安全是开发的重中之重。
- 用户教育:很多消费者对于加密货币依然持怀疑态度,如何教育用户,让他们理解并接受这项新兴技术是推广的关键。
- 市场波动:加密货币市场波动较大,这可能会影响消费者和商家的使用意愿。这种不确定性需要通过一些方式来进行管理,如将加密货币兑换成稳定币来降低风险。
FAQs:相关问题探讨
加密货币支付的安全性如何保障?
加密货币支付系统的安全性是一个复杂且多维度的问题,涉及技术、用户操作及监管等多个方面。以下是一些关键点:
- 安全的私钥管理:用户的私钥是访问其加密货币的唯一凭证,因此,如何安全存储私钥尤为重要。热钱包虽然方便,但容易受到黑客攻击;冷钱包则提供更高的安全性。
- 多重认证机制:引入多重认证可以大大提高账户安全性。例如,通过短信验证码、邮件确认等方式,确保用户独立确认其交易请求。
- 定期安全审计:定期对系统进行安全审计,及时发现并修补漏洞。这能够有效降低黑客攻击的风险,并增强用户的信任。
- 教育用户:终端用户的安全意识至关重要,通过教育提高用户对网络钓鱼及欺诈的警觉性,可以大大减少安全问题的发生。
如何促进消费者对加密货币支付的接受度?
消费者对加密货币的接受度主要取决于对其安全性、便利性以及合法性的认知。以下是促进接受度的一些策略:
- 提供教育资源:开发方应提供详细的教育资料,帮助消费者理解加密货币的优势和潜在风险。举办线上线下讲座、研讨会等活动也是非常有效的方式。
- 建立信任机制:用户对新技术的信任往往来自于可靠的第三方机构。可以寻求与知名金融机构、技术公司合作,营造可信赖的市场环境。
- 提供优良的用户体验:简单的用户界面和顺畅的交易过程可以显著提升用户的使用意愿。消费体验好,用户自然愿意尝试新兴的支付方式。
- 激励措施:可以通过提供折扣、返现或其他奖励措施来吸引更多人使用加密货币进行支付。
加密货币支付在国际贸易中的应用前景如何?
加密货币支付在国际贸易中展现出极大的潜力,这主要体现在以下几个方面:
- 降低跨境交易成本:传统国际贸易中,跨境支付往往需要经历多层中介,手续费昂贵。而使用加密货币则可以去除中介,直接进行点对点的交易,降低交易成本。
- 提高交易速度:国际汇款通常需要数天时间,而加密货币交易则可以在几分钟内完成,提高资金流动效率。
- 增强透明度:区块链技术提供的透明性可以减少跨国贸易中的欺诈风险,保护交易双方的权益。
- 助力无银行账户人群:在许多发展中地区,人们并不具备银行账户,加密货币可以为他们提供参与全球经济的机会。
未来的加密货币支付市场将会如何发展?
未来,加密货币支付市场将会经历剧烈的变化与发展,以下是一些可能的趋势:
- 稳定币的兴起:为了应对加密货币价格波动大导致的风险,稳定币将成为重要的支付工具。稳定币通常与法定货币挂钩,可以降低交易风险而保持加密货币的优势。
- 智能合约的广泛应用:随着技术的进步,智能合约将会在支付系统中发挥更为重要的作用,自动执行合同条款,提供更加便捷的交易体验。
- 规范化与监管趋严:各国对加密货币的监管将愈加严格,帐号注册、身份认证等措施将成为主流。在此过程中,将促使市场健康发展。
- 技术的不断演进:随着技术的进步,加密货币支付系统将更加安全、高效,形成更完善的生态系统,促进其大规模应用。
总的来说,加密货币支付的发展是一个复杂且充满潜力的领域,不仅需要技术上的创新和提升,更需要在法律、市场和用户教育等各方面进行全面的推动。作为开发者,抓住这一趋势,将为未来的金融科技产业打开新的大门。
tpwallet
T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。